What are some of the best western fiction books?

Some of the top western fiction books include 'Shane' by Jack Schaefer. It's a simple yet powerful story about a gunslinger. 'The Ox - Bow Incident' by Walter Van Tilburg Clark is also excellent. It shows the darker side of frontier justice. And 'Centennial' by James Michener is a great choice too. It gives a detailed look at the history of the American West through fictional characters and events.

One of the best is 'Lonesome Dove' by Larry McMurtry. It's a classic that vividly portrays the lives of Texas Rangers on a cattle drive. Another great one is 'True Grit' by Charles Portis. The character of Mattie Ross is really memorable. And 'The Virginian' by Owen Wister is also highly regarded as it was one of the first novels to really define the western genre.

What are some of the best western historical fiction books?

Well, 'Riders of the Purple Sage' by Zane Grey is a top pick. It's full of action, adventure, and the wild west setting. Then there's 'Blood Meridian' by Cormac McCarthy. It's a darker take on the west, exploring themes like violence and survival. 'True Grit' by Charles Portis is also excellent, with a strong - willed female protagonist seeking revenge in the western frontier.

What are the best science fiction western books?

The 'Leviathan Wakes' by James S.A. Corey is great. It has a setting that combines the vastness of space (science fiction aspect) with a frontier - like feel similar to the western genre. There are conflicts over resources, exploration, and the characters have to be tough and resourceful, much like in a western.

What are the best sci fi western fiction books?

I would recommend 'West of Eden' by Harry Harrison. It takes place in a future where dinosaurs were never extinct and humans have to co - exist with them, much like settlers in the Old West had to deal with wild animals. The story has all the adventure and exploration aspects of a Western, but in a completely different, sci - fi setting. There are also political intrigues and power struggles, just like in a classic Western story.
